CoO x incorporated in Ag/reduced graphene oxide nanocomposites (CoO x -Ag/rGO) were synthesized through an one-pot solvothermal method. Electrochemical results showed that CoO x nanoparticles could greatly promote dispersion of anchored Ag nanoparticles and increase the limiting current density for the whole CoO x -Ag/rGO nanocomposites when catalyzing oxygen reduction...
